IIS 7.5 - 没有扩展名导致错误404.17的文件

时间:2013-05-16 14:03:41

标签: .net asp.net-mvc iis

我目前正在开发一个ASP.NET MVC4网站,我正在努力为JQuery Flot添加date.js的javascript时区支持。

date.js的时区信息存储在没有扩展名的文本文件中(例如:tz / northamerica)。

使用Visual Studio开发服务器时,我可以毫无问题地获取任何时区文件,但是一旦使用IIS托管,我就会收到以下错误:

  

HTTP错误404.17 - 未找到

     

请求的内容似乎是脚本,不会提供   静态文件处理程序。

     

最有可能原因:

     

请求与通配符mime映射匹配。请求映射到   静态文件处理程序如果有不同的前提条件,那么   请求将映射到不同的处理程序。

     

你可以尝试的事情:

     

如果要将此内容作为静态文件提供,请添加显式内容   MIME地图。

我网站的其余部分工作正常,只有那些扩展较少的文件才会导致打嗝。

我对IIS配置非常不熟悉,这究竟是什么问题?

1 个答案:

答案 0 :(得分:2)

看起来IIS 7.5的问题是you can patch